Hi Priya — handover for the evac-chair store at Thornholt House: chairs were serviced last month, tags are on the frames. New starters should be shown the store on day one (door by Stair B, level 3). Keep the log sheet updated. The door needs the keypad code below.

door code, kawip-bagap: bdg-HQEWH-4

## Data Stores — ConsentGate Rollout

This page documents where the ConsentGate banner service persists data, for security review ahead of the Pellworth region rollout. Consent records are append-only: each row captures banner version, choice vector, and a salted visitor token — no raw identifiers are stored. Retention is 26 months, enforced by a nightly pruning job. Access is restricted to the consent-svc role; application code never holds write credentials beyond that role. The primary consent store is reachable via the following:

replica DSN, kajep-yahag: mssql://praok_svc:iF@db-8d68.plorvaio.local:5432/eliion

MINUTES — Heads of Department Meeting, Tarvik Logistics

Mr. Ollenby presented the proposed training budget for next year: a 9% increase overall, weighted toward the Fleet Systems team and the new Cargoway certification track. Ms. Drell questioned the external-vendor spend; a breakdown will circulate next week. Department heads must submit headcount-linked training forecasts by the 15th. The committee agreed that allocation decisions should align with the company's broader direction, which is outlined in the confidential note below.

confidential, bahap-bajog: Zorethix Works is in early talks to buy Kelethox Foods for about $30.7 million. The Ralvan launch date is September 19, and nothing goes to the press before then.